1.) Something is very wrong with your WiFi or your microwave.
From Cisco
"a microwave oven operating at the same frequency as one of your 802.11 access points can reduce the effective throughput and capacity of your access by 50 percent."

True, that's not completely out, but it is significant interference.
 
I have seen an old cordless phone kill wifi on channel 1, as soon as I switched it to 11 it was fine.
